i will be a bit more helpful than just parroting that though.
you need to focus on learning their attack patterns. focus on dodging before anything else. once you know their patterns and understand their timing, then you can turn around and start dealing damage. also, you really need to focus on stamina management. the quickest way to die is to run out of stamina and not be able to dodge away.
really these guys are pretty easy to deal with. it just takes some practice.
There are 3 distinct styles in DS3
1. Light builds with lots of dodging. These builds are often caster builds.
2. Shield builds (need to never roll ever; it is dfferent playstyle)
3. Giant two-handed dads (no rolling needed, minimum rolling; they break guards and stagger bosses; they trade damage with bosses)
I mentioned in your other post, but an easy way to deal with em is with a sword. Get any straightsword and stance r1 while the cowards are holding up their greatshields. Instant guardbreak. Stack a fire pine bundle before you riposte them and you'll deal that massive dmg easily. Heavy atk em while they're getting back up and the knight should be dead.
Tell him to drop you a flamberge. Has low stats req and drops from an early enemy in the area just after highwall, but its a very rare drop. Deals really good damage if you infuse with heavy too.
